Blaine running back Caleb Statham has been voted the Football Athlete of the Week, sponsored by Aaron Dickson of Rice Insurance, in an online poll.
Statham received 75.6 percent (87 votes) of the 115 votes cast at TheBellinghamHerald.com/sports, beating out Ferndale's Willy Scott and Meridian's Mitchell Tripp.
Statham rushed for 186 yards and a season-high four touchdowns on 15 carries - all in the first half - of the Borderites' 51-0 victory over Bellingham on Thursday, Oct. 29, at Civic Stadium. The big game helped him cement his Northwest Conference leads in rushing yards (1,229 this season) and points scored (108).
"Caleb did an outstanding job of following his blockers," Blaine coach Jay Dodd said. "There is usually an unblocked player that the running back has to make miss, and he made that player miss a few times in our Bellingham game."
Blaine travels to Cedarcrest for a Class 2A Northwest District playoff game at 7 p.m. on Friday, Nov. 6, hoping to earn its third straight trip to state and its sixth overall
